NAF tapered roller bearings are a type of rolling element bearing that is commonly used in heavy-duty applications. These bearings consist of tapered inner and outer raceways, as well as tapered rollers that are held in place by a cage. This unique design allows tapered roller bearings to handle both radial and axial loads, making them ideal for heavy-duty applications.
One of the key advantages of tapered roller bearings is their ability to handle high radial and axial loads. This makes them ideal for applications where there is a high degree of stress on the bearings, such as in the automotive and construction industries. The tapered design of the bearing also ensures that there is a large contact area between the rollers and the raceways, which helps to distribute the load evenly across the bearing.
Another advantage of tapered roller bearings is their durability. These bearings are designed to withstand heavy use over an extended period, making them ideal for applications where there is a high degree of wear and tear. They also have a relatively low coefficient of friction, which helps to reduce the amount of heat generated and extends the lifespan of the bearing.
Tapered roller bearings also offer high precision and accuracy. This is particularly useful in applications where there is a need for high-speed rotation or precise alignment. The rollers and raceways are carefully designed and manufactured to exacting standards, ensuring that the bearing runs smoothly and accurately at all times.
